Make Your FastPass+ Reservations Early
Making your FastPass+ reservations as early as possible is key to getting the most out of your trip to Disney World. To enhance your strategy, you should try and book the passes at least 60 days before the start of your trip.
FastPass+ allows you to skip the lines for some of Disney’s most popular attractions, including rides, shows, and character meet-and-greets. You can reserve up to three FastPasses per day in advance on each park day ticket, and they are available for one-hour time slots.
The earlier you book them, the more options you will have in terms of times and attractions to choose from. There is no cost for reserving a FastPass+, so make sure to take advantage of this great service!

Take Advantage of Rider Switch
Taking advantage of Rider Switch is a great way to ensure everyone in your party can enjoy their favorite attractions without waiting in line. This rider etiquette allows families with small children to split into two parties, where one group rides the attraction while the other waits. When the first party finishes, they can then switch off and take turns riding without having to wait in line again.

Is there a limit to the number of FastPass+ reservations I can make?
Yes, there is a limit to the number of Fastpass+ reservations you can make. You are limited to 3 initial reservations per day with specific waiting times and time slots. After you’ve used your first 3 passes, you can add more if available.
